What is WPCursor?
WPCursor is an AI builder for creating WordPress pages and components through conversation. Instead of generating a generic template, it produces production-ready HTML, CSS, and JavaScript directly for your WordPress site and prompts you to review and refine before publishing.
The core purpose is to help people describe what they need (for example, a full landing page, a widget, or a section) and have WPCursor configure the WordPress ecosystem around that request—working with common WordPress tools and plugins rather than staying outside the platform.
Key Features
- Conversation-to-page building: Describe what you want and WPCursor generates full pages in one conversation, aimed at production use rather than template output.
- Review and refine before publishing: Generated content can be iterated with further prompts before you place it live on WordPress.
- Production components built from a design system: Pricing tables, hero sections, testimonial grids, and interactive forms are described as components that can be reused across multiple pages.
- Plugin and ecosystem understanding inside WordPress: WPCursor is positioned as operating within WordPress and “wires data” between the plugin configuration and the UI.
- Code output aligned to WordPress needs: Component generation includes H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, and the product references generating snippets and widgets.
- Works with multiple WordPress editors and common tools: The site content mentions compatibility with Elementor and the Gutenberg (native block editor) workflow, with “Divi coming soon,” plus support for ACF & CPT Custom Snippets, custom widgets, WooCommerce, Yoast, ACF/CPT, and form tools.

Alternatives
- AI website builders (template-based or visual canvas tools): These typically generate pages outside WordPress and may require manual integration or theme/template alignment, whereas WPCursor is positioned as operating within WordPress and producing production pages/components.
- WordPress page builders and block editors (manual/assisted layout): Tools like visual page builders focus on designing and arranging content directly in the editor; WPCursor’s differentiator is generating page structure and code from conversation prompts.
- Freelancers/agency development workflow: Human implementation can provide custom code and design control, but the source frames WPCursor as reducing back-and-forth and waiting times by shipping changes through conversation instead of tickets and sprints.
- Code-first WordPress development (themes/plugins): Developers may build with PHP/JS and custom theme components; WPCursor’s output is intended to generate usable production pages/components without requiring direct code editing from the user.
